MATH 95 — Mathematical Literacy
This course serves as a prerequisite for General Education Statistics (MATH 107) and Liberal Arts Mathematics (MATH 111). The primary goal of this course is to enable students to develop conceptual understanding and problem-solving competence at the intermediate algebra level. This course emphasizes conceptual understanding and modeling rather than procedures. However certain procedures are essential to the study of algebra and they will be included. This course focuses on developing mathematical maturity through problem-solving, critical thinking, data analysis, and the writing and communication of mathematics. Students will develop conceptual and procedural tools that support the use of key mathematical concepts in a variety of contexts.
Prerequisites: MATH 93
